While a lot of IRAs buy standard properties like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code likewise permits special "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" IRAs that can hold physical silver or gold. However not all rare-earth elements are permitted. gold 401k rollover - work directly with owners. In fact, the law names specific gold, silver and platinum coins that qualify like the American Gold Eagle and defines purity requirements for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also states the gold or silver must be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A online marketers declare there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). However the proof is blended on whether owning gold can really keep your cost savings safe. For starters, while gold can supply some insurance against inflation, simply how much depends on your timing and patience. "Gold does tend to hold its value in the long-term, but it is also unpredictable roughly as unstable as stocks so you might require years to ride out its ups and downs," says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for people who are retired or near ret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for example, when inflation almost do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al truly took off - rollover my 401k into gold. It rose by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of approximately $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ed just 34%. Since then, however, gold has actually fallen by about a 3rd in worth,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The TIPS contrast brings up one key distinction in between rare-earth elements and other financial investments: they have no earnings st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their cost swings. What's more, valuable metals have substantial pur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ds do not share. For starters, there are base costs and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 cost to open an account and around $225 a year to store and guarantee your holdings at a protected dep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that cash back on a much more substantial cost: the "spread," or space in between the wholesale cost the company pays to acquire the metal and the list price it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for instance, recently used an Individual Retirement Account Reward Program that got $500 of fees for clients who purchased least $50,000 in silver or gold. However the business's Deal Agreement said the spread on coins and bullion sold to Individual Retirement Account customers "normally" ranged in between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a customer who opened a $50,000 Individual Retirement Account would pay $8,500 for the spread and receive just $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left a lot of margin for Lear to recoup that $500 bonus.

If you offer the gold or silver to a third-party dealer, you might lose money on another spread, since dealers generally wish to pay less than what they believe they can get for the metal on the open market (rollover 401k into gold ira). To assist clients prevent that risk, some IRA companies will buy back your gold at, state, the then-prevailing wholesale rate. However, thanks to the initial spread our hypothetical investor paid to open her $50,000 Individual Retirement Account, she would require gold prices to increase by over 20% simply to recover cost. Compare that to the expense of a standard IRA, where opening and closing an account is typically complimentary and deals may cost just $8 per trade.

However expect disaster truly does strike. How would you redeem your gold if it's sitting in a depository midway across the nation? To attend to that concern, a few alternative Individual Retirement Account consultants point to a wrinkle in the tax code that they say could let you keep your rare-earth elements close by such as in a local bank safe deposit box or in the house. Basically, the business helps you set up what's called a restricted liability business (LLC) and location that business into a self-directed Individual Retirement Account. The LLC then purchases the gold and selects where to save it. The drawback to this technique is that it appears to run counter to the desires of the Internal Profits Service (Internal Revenue Service).

Tax concerns aside, economists state there is a far more cost-efficient way to add gold to your retirement portfolio: invest in an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the price of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are basically trusts that own huge quantities of gold bullion - 401k to gold ira rollover guide. SPDR Gold, for example, has almost $34 billion in gold bars embeded a huge underground vault in London where workers in titanium-toed shoes drive the stuff around on forklifts.

There's no minimum financial investment except the cost of a single share, which recently varied from around $5 to roughly $120, depending on the ETF. And due to the fact that the funds purchase and store gold in bulk, their business expenses are comparatively low (401k to gold rollover no penalty). SPDR Gold's yearly costs are capped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ings annually, for example, or somewhere in between the expense of an index fund and an actively handled fund. Gold is normally thought about to be a safe investment and a hedge against inflation because the cost of the metal goes up when the U.S. dollar goes down. One thing investors need to consider is that the majority of 401( k) retirement strategies do not enable the direct ownership of physical gold or gold derivatives such as futures or choices agreements. can rollover my 401k to gold. However, there are some indirect methods to get your hands on some gold in your 401( k).



Nevertheless, gold IRAs do exist that specialize in holding precious metals for retirement savings. Financiers can however discover specific shared funds or ETFs that hold gold or gold mining stocks through their 401( k) s. Rolling over a 401( k) to a self-directed IRA may give financiers higher access to more diverse kinds of investment in gold. solo 401k plan gold rollover.
